Mamata Banerjee government to include Swami Vivekananda’s famous 1893 speech in Class IX to XII syllabus from next year

Kolkata: The West Bengal government, on Wednesday, decided to include Swami Vivekananda’s famous speech at the Parliament of World’s Religion in Chicago in the Class IX to XII syllabus from next year, state education minister Partha Chatterjee said. Image courtesy: www.belurmath.org[/caption] The proposal to include Vivekananda’s speech was given by the representatives of the Ramakrishna Mission at the first meeting held by the committee, which was constituted to look after the celebrations of 125 years of Vivekananda’s address at the Parliament of World’s Religion in Chicago in 1893, held at the secretariat on Wednesday. The meeting was presided by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ee amid the presence of Chatterjee and other senior officials. The syllabus committee will take the final call on the inclusion of the leader’s speech. The state government also decided to grant another Rs 10 crore to the Mission for the proposed Centre of Excellence.  Earlier, the state had granted another Rs 10 crore for the same. Incidentally, the state government had decided to conduct character-building programmes in schools as part of the celebrations of 125 years of Vivekananda’s address at the Parliament of World’s Religion in Chicago.
